Kurdish interior minister to resign – ministry

BAGHDAD / IraqiNews.com: Interior minister of Iraq’s Kurdistan region, Othman Hajj Mahmoud, suspended his work to present his official resignation, the ministry’s undersecretary said on Tuesday. “Minister of Peshmerga affairs in the region, Shabakh Jaafar Sheikh Mustapha, will replace the minister for the meantime until a crucial decision can be made regarding the resignation,” Jalal Karim told IraqiNews.com news agency. “The resignation came after disagreements in the Patriotic Union of Kurdistan (PUK),” he explained. President Jalal Talabani is the leader of the PUK, one of two main Kurdish parties. The other one, the Kurdistan Democratic Party (KDP), is led by the Iraqi Kurdistan Region President Massoud Barazani. SH (P)/SR 1
